On Thursday, November 15, 2001, at 03:12 , Simson Garfinkel wrote:

I'm looking for documentation on how to create sub-projects in
ProjectBuilder. So far, I haven't found anything.

Any pointers would be appreciated.

The new PB doesn't support sub-projects, they were replaced by multiple
targets & the ability to let one target depend on another (target-tab).
